Stans Energy Corp. Initiates Preparation of a JORC Compliant Resource Estimate for Kutessay II

Stans Energy Corp (“Stans” or “The Company”) has initiated preparation of a JORC compliant resource estimate for Kutessay II. One of the objectives of the estimate is to confirm the historic reserve estimate completed by the State Reserve Committee of the Kyrgyz Republic. The historical reserve estimate by the State Reserve Committee is not JORC compliant.

Stans has made changes to its website and corporate presentation to comply with NI 43-101‟s 2.2 (c) and 4.2 (2) including deleting items that do not comply and including a disclaimer on „historical reserves‟ and „historical resources‟ that these items are not NI 43-101 compliant.
The Company has also filed two material contracts with Viol Energy (formerly Viol Grand) on Sedar, signed in 2005 and 2009, regarding the acquisition of Viol Energy‟s three exploration licenses in the Kyrgyz Republic.

About Stans Energy
Stans Energy Corp. is focused on developing properties containing Rare Earth Elements (REEs), Uranium, and Associated Metals. The company continuously examines and evaluates new opportunities to acquire and develop proven resource properties in areas of the former Soviet Union. The headquarters of the company is located in Toronto, Ontario, Canada, and its wholly-owned subsidiary, Stans Energy KG, is located in Bishkek, Kyrgyzstan. Stans Energy Corp’s Chairman, Rodney Irwin, was the former ambassador to the Russian Federation for Canada, and currently serves as the Honorary Consul of the Kyrgyz Republic for Canada.
